Oracle 数据库常用函数解析15整数(oracle 1-5整数)

Oracle 数据库常用函数解析:15整数

在 Oracle 数据库中,整数是一种常见的数据类型,同时也有很多针对整数的常用函数。本文将介绍 15 种 Oracle 数据库常用函数,涵盖了整数的各个方面。

1. ABS

ABS 函数用于返回一个数的绝对值,该函数的语法如下:

“`SQL

ABS(n)


其中,n 是一个数值表达式。

示例:

```SQL
SELECT ABS(-15) FROM dual; -- 结果为 15

2. CEIL

CEIL 函数用于向上取整,该函数的语法如下:

“`SQL

CEIL(n)


其中,n 是一个数值表达式。

示例:

```SQL
SELECT CEIL(10.3) FROM dual; -- 结果为 11

3. FLOOR

FLOOR 函数用于向下取整,该函数的语法如下:

“`SQL

FLOOR(n)


其中,n 是一个数值表达式。

示例:

```SQL
SELECT FLOOR(10.7) FROM dual; -- 结果为 10

4. EXP

EXP 函数返回以 e(自然对数)为底数的指定数的指数值,该函数的语法如下:

“`SQL

EXP(n)


其中,n 是一个数值表达式。

示例:

```SQL
SELECT EXP(2) FROM dual; -- 结果为 7.38905609893065

5. LN

LN 函数返回指定数的自然对数,该函数的语法如下:

“`SQL

LN(n)


其中,n 是一个数值表达式。

示例:

```SQL
SELECT LN(15) FROM dual; -- 结果为 2.70805020110221

6. LOG

LOG 函数返回指定数的对数,该函数的语法如下:

“`SQL

LOG(base, n)


其中,base 是指定的底数,n 是一个数值表达式。

示例:

```SQL
SELECT LOG(10, 100) FROM dual; -- 结果为 2

7. MOD

MOD 函数返回被除数除以除数所得的余数,该函数的语法如下:

“`SQL

MOD(n1, n2)


其中,n1 和 n2 都是数值表达式。

示例:

```SQL
SELECT MOD(10, 3) FROM dual; -- 结果为 1

8. POWER

POWER 函数返回指定数的指定次幂,该函数的语法如下:

“`SQL

POWER(n1, n2)


其中,n1 是指定的数,n2 是指定的次数。

示例:

```SQL
SELECT POWER(2, 3) FROM dual; -- 结果为 8

9. ROUND

ROUND 函数将一个数四舍五入到指定的小数位数,该函数的语法如下:

“`SQL

ROUND(n, [p])


其中,n 是要进行四舍五入的数值表达式,p 是要保留的小数位数。

示例:

```SQL
SELECT ROUND(3.14159, 2) FROM dual; -- 结果为 3.14

10. SIGN

SIGN 函数返回指定数的符号,该函数的语法如下:

“`SQL

SIGN(n)


其中,n 是数值表达式。

示例:

```SQL
SELECT SIGN(-5) FROM dual; -- 结果为 -1

11. SQRT

SQRT 函数返回指定数的平方根,该函数的语法如下:

“`SQL

SQRT(n)


其中,n 是数值表达式。

示例:

```SQL
SELECT SQRT(25) FROM dual; -- 结果为 5

12. TRUNC

TRUNC 函数将一个数截取到指定的小数位数,该函数的语法如下:

“`SQL

TRUNC(n, [p])


其中,n 是要进行截取的数值表达式,p 是要保留的小数位数。

示例:

```SQL
SELECT TRUNC(3.14159, 2) FROM dual; -- 结果为 3.14

13. ASCII

ASCII 函数返回字符的 ASCII 码值,该函数的语法如下:

“`SQL

ASCII(c)


其中,c 是要进行转换的字符。

示例:

```SQL
SELECT ASCII('A') FROM dual; -- 结果为 65

14. CHR

CHR 函数返回给定 ASCII 码值的字符,该函数的语法如下:

“`SQL

CHR(n)


其中,n 是 ASCII 码值。

示例:

```SQL
SELECT CHR(65) FROM dual; -- 结果为 A

15. LENGTH

LENGTH 函数返回字符串中的字符数,该函数的语法如下:

“`SQL

LENGTH(s)


其中,s 是字符串表达式。

示例:

```SQL
SELECT LENGTH('Hello') FROM dual; -- 结果为 5

以上就是 Oracle 数据库常用函数解析中关于整数的 15 种常用函数,通过掌握这些函数,可以更好地进行整数的处理和计算。


数据运维技术 » Oracle 数据库常用函数解析15整数(oracle 1-5整数)